Getting There

  • Car Rental

    If you are starting from Mendi, the capital of Southern Highlands Province, you can rent a car. From Mendi, take the Highlands Highway (also known as the Mendi-Kutubu Road) heading southeast towards Lake Kutubu. The drive is approximately 60 kilometers and takes around 1.5 to 2 hours depending on road conditions. Keep an eye out for road signs directing you to Lake Kutubu. Be cautious as the roads can be narrow and winding.

  • Public Transport (Bus)

    From Mendi, you can take a public bus heading towards Lake Kutubu. Buses leave from the main bus terminal in Mendi. Make sure to confirm with the driver that the bus will stop at or near Lake Kutubu, as some may only go to nearby villages. The bus fare is typically around 20 to 30 PGK (Papua New Guinean Kina), and the journey may take approximately 2 to 3 hours, depending on stops and road conditions.

  • Hiking/Walking

    If you are adventurous and already in a nearby village like Daga, you can consider hiking to Lake Kutubu. There are trails that connect the surrounding villages to the lake. However, ensure you have a local guide to navigate the paths as they can be challenging, and it's advisable to carry sufficient water and snacks. The hike may take several hours, so plan accordingly.

  • Local Transport (Taxi or Boda Boda)

    In Mendi and surrounding areas, you can hire a local taxi or use a Boda Boda (motorbike taxi) to take you closer to Lake Kutubu. Negotiate the fare in advance, as prices can vary. Expect to pay around 50 to 100 PGK for a short taxi ride to a nearby village from where you may walk to the lake. Boda Boda fares are generally cheaper.

Discover more about Lake Kutubu

Lake Kutubu is a breathtaking freshwater lake located in the Southern Highlands Province of Papua New Guinea. Surrounded by lush green mountains and dense rainforest, this hidden gem is renowned for its stunning landscapes and vibrant ecosystem. The lake is not only a sanctuary for diverse wildlife, including rare bird species and unique aquatic life, but also a significant cultural site for the local communities. Visitors to Lake Kutubu can engage with the indigenous people, learning about their traditions and way of life while enjoying the serene atmosphere that the lake provides. The best time to visit is during the dry season, from May to October, when the weather is pleasant, and the views are crystal clear. Activities around the lake include hiking, bird watching, and cultural tours, which allow tourists to immerse themselves in the local heritage. Fishing is also popular, providing an opportunity for visitors to experience the local cuisine firsthand.
